CU53 HSY is a 2003 Hyundai Terracan in Silver with a 2,902c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 70.6%.

Across all 2003 Hyundai Terracan models, the average MOT pass rate is 70.9% with a typical mileage of 80,488 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Hyundai Terracan f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 3,285 recorded failures. If you're considering buying CU53 HSY,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Hyundai Terracan typically stays on UK roads for around 23 years. At 23 years old, this Hyundai Terracan is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
